Dear all, I have the very strong impression that our friend MARIO PASCUCCI is credited as MAX FRASER in the films `E VENNE IL TEMPO DI UCCIDERE` (1968) and `L'ULTIMO KILLER`(1967). (There are no other credits for a ´Max Fraser`). For the first I have the ´Fraser` playing the telegraph operator, and we have the pic for this role by Ghibarian. In the second film, Fraser is credited and Pascucci is appearing as a Gambler in the Saloon. What do you think?
